How much do packaging supervisor j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for packaging supervisor in Florida is $45,604.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$35,500.00 and $52,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ges packaging supervisors face when managing a production line, and how can they address them?

Packaging Supervisors often encounter challenges such as maintaining production efficiency, ensuring product quality, and minimizing downtime due to equipment malfunctions or supply shortages. To address these, supervisors closely monitor workflows, coordinate with maintenance and supply chain teams, and implement process improvements. Effective communication with staff and regular training also help in quickly identifying and resolving issues, maintaining a smooth and safe operation.

What does a packaging supervisor do?

A packaging supervisor oversees the packaging process in a manufacturing or distribution environment, ensuring products are packed efficiently, accurately, and safely. They coordinate staff, monitor quality standards, and may use tools like inventory management systems to meet production goals and maintain safety protocols.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a packaging supervisor?

A Packaging Supervisor typically needs experience in manufacturing, knowledge of packaging processes, and a background in quality control, often supported by a degree in engineering, logistics, or a related field. Familiarity with production management software, automated packaging machinery, and safety regulations is essential. Strong leadership,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ills help motivate teams and resolve operational issues efficiently. These competencies are crucial for ensuring productivity, maintaining quality standards, and fostering a safe and collaborative work environment.

What is the difference between Packaging Supervisor vs Packaging Technician?

AspectPackaging SupervisorPackaging Technician
CredentialsHigh school diploma; often some supervisory or industry-specific certificationsHigh school diploma or equivalent; technical training or certifications may be preferred
Work EnvironmentSupervises packaging lines, manages staff, oversees operationsOperates packaging machinery, performs manual packaging tasks
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, food, and consumer goods industriesFound in similar industries, focusing on hands-on packaging tasks

The Packaging Supervisor oversees packaging operations and manages staff, ensuring efficiency and quality. The Packaging Technician focuses on operating packaging equipment and performing manual tasks. While both roles require industry-specific knowledge, the supervisor has more managerial responsibilities, whereas the technician is more hands-on.

Job Summary

The Packaging Supervisor will oversee our organization's production process operations. This will include, but not be limited to, safe oversight and operation of the production areas of the facility. This role will ensure the safe and optimized operation of packaging equipment used in processing food safe medical cannabis oils and liquids for ingestion, inhalation, or topical application by registered patients/customers (in applicable states). The ideal candidate will be highly organized and able to ensure that production operations remain smooth, methodical, and efficient. The role requires the ability to lead employees, organize the workflow in the Production Area, and work with other departments in a professional manner as well as scheduling equipment maintenance.

Duties and Responsibilities

  • Responsible for ensuring a Safe working environment by performing Safety Audits and Safety Corrective Actions as required.
  • Responsible for the adherence and management of the AYR Operating System (AOS) within the assigned area.
  • Responsible for the scheduling of labor and management of daily adjustments to ensure production requirements are achieved.
  • Responsible for hourly/daily auditing of their area of responsibility to ensure the team has all the proper tools necessary to be successful.
  • Responsible for mentoring, developing, and providing direction to direct reports
  • Supports process and product launches by providing departmental process knowledge and feedback to ensure successful launches. Manage weekly time and attendance system for timely processing of employee payroll transactions
  • Lead and implement LEAN Manufacturing practices.
  • Commitment and execution of all operations in an efficient manner that also complies with State Regulations, FDA cGMP's, OSHA regulations, Ayr Wellness SOP's, and all applicable processing procedures (Batch records)
  • Operational knowledge of all applicable and essential equipment and the ability to oversee and schedule regular maintenance.
  • Responsible for ensuring batch records are completed in a timely and accurate to ensure proper process flow of materials. Audits processes to ensure compliance and accuracy involving all product tracking, product security, and product movement procedures.
  • Perform in-process sampling, results analyses, and visual inspections to ensure all product meets or exceeds Ayr Wellness specifications and as per batch record requirements. Such work shall include but not be limited to:
  • Responsible for proper inventory control in their assigned areas.
  • Additional duties as assigned.
